Subject: [PATCH v2 6/9] ARM: dts: qcom: apq8064: Add syscon for sic-non-secure
Date: Mon, 28 Mar 2016 20:37:02 -0700 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<1459222625-11440-7-git-send-email-bjorn.andersson@linaro.org>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<1459222625-11440-1-git-send-email-bjorn.andersson@linaro.org>
Signed-off-by: Bjorn Andersson <bjorn.andersson@linaro.org>
---
Andy, this is only here for context, please apply separately.
Changes since v1:
- Added dts patches
arch/arm/boot/dts/qcom-apq8064.dtsi | 5 +++++
1 file changed, 5 insertions(+)
diff --git a/arch/arm/boot/dts/qcom-apq8064.dtsi b/arch/arm/boot/dts/qcom-apq8064.dtsi
index 65d0e8d98259..9d45c4ef4a97 100644
--- a/arch/arm/boot/dts/qcom-apq8064.dtsi
+++ b/arch/arm/boot/dts/qcom-apq8064.dtsi
@@ -212,6 +212,11 @@
regulator;
};
+ sic_non_secure: sic-non-secure@12100000 {
+ compatible = "syscon";
+ reg = <0x12100000 0x10000>;
+ };
+
gsbi1: gsbi@12440000 {
status = "disabled";
compatible = "qcom,gsbi-v1.0.0";
